Get ready for an exhilarating weekend getaway as the highly anticipated West Coast Airshow and Music Concert takes over Saldanha Airfield this September. This 14-hour event promises to be an unforgettable experience filled with roaring jet engines, incredible aerial feats, and amazing memories.

Aerial Extravaganza: High-Flying Performances

The West Coast Airshow is a premier aviation event that features heart-stopping aerial displays and awe-inspiring performances. Starting at 9 am, spectators will enjoy six hours of adrenaline-charged aerial maneuvers and astonishing feats of aviation prowess. The daredevil performances include high-performance jets, iconic helicopters, and legendary aircraft, showcasing the incredible skills of pilots such as Dave Mandel, Grant Timm, Juba Joubert, and Derek Lord.

During the lunch break, attendees have a unique opportunity to interact with pilots and explore the aircraft up close. Then, from 3 pm to 5 pm, drones and captivating activities take center stage.

Empowering Futures: Career Exploration and Drone Dynamics

Stellenbosch University sponsors the Youth Development Program and hosts a career expo alongside its Faculty of Military Science and the Military Academy, offering exploration opportunities. Drone enthusiasts will be captivated by displays from industry leaders like Autonosky, Skyhook Drones, and Integrated Aerial Systems Drones, as well as an attempt to set a new drone speed record by the FlyFPV SA team.

Beyond the Skies: Music Concert Extravaganza

As the sun sets, the spotlight shifts from aerial displays to a highly anticipated music concert. A star-studded lineup featuring Mel Botes, Corné Louw, the West Coast Youth Orchestra’s Marimba ensemble, Sandveld Stoftrappers, and headliner Karen Zoid will captivate audiences from 5 pm to 10:30 pm.

The Nelson Mandela Commemorative Centre and School of Public Governance is a monument being developed in Cape Town, South Africa to celebrate the legacy of late President Nelson Mandela. It will cultivate ethical leadership and shape future generations of leaders, and will feature interactive public art pieces, reflective paths, and communal spaces. The center, which will house the Nelson Mandela School of Public Governance, is committed to nurturing upcoming leaders from throughout Africa and standing as a symbol of ethical leadership and a brighter future.

‘Just Now Jeffrey’, a South African film directed by Hylton Tannenbaum, is gaining global recognition for its unfiltered portrayal of Apartheidera South Africa. The movie explores teenage issues against the backdrop of political turmoil, providing an authentic glimpse into the country’s complexities. Despite being produced independently, the film has been showcased at the Beverly Hills Film Festival and is set to be featured at other festivals around the world.

The tragic murder of fiveyearold Ditebogo Phalane in South Africa has prompted a thorough investigation by law enforcement agencies. Recently, the TOMS squad of the Hawks’ Pretoria division, working jointly with the Akasia Crime Prevention Unit and Tshwane District CI, made arrests in the case and discovered two illegal firearms, one suspected to be the murder weapon. One of the suspects was out on bail at the time of his arrest, highlighting the challenges faced by law enforcement in upholding peace and order.
